Challenging Claims of Jesus Being a Palestinian Refugee: John Hayward’s Perspective

Over the Christmas holiday, CNN featured religion correspondent Father Edward Beck, who shared a thought-provoking take on the true story of Christmas. Beck called it “The story of Christmas is about a Palestinian Jew born into an occupied country, having to flee as refugees into Egypt.” CNN also tweeted another bold statement that “if Jesus were born today he would be born in Gaza under rubble.” But it seems that Bethlehem isn’t in Gaza. CNN seems to be working on its handling of Christianity. Breitbart’s John Hayward had some thoughts on this, taking on all of these hot takes about Jesus being a Palestinian refugee.
